    The History of the Treadmill

    The treadmill is a vital piece of equipment that is found in many gyms and fitness rooms. It's also a popular piece of equipment in homes across the globe. However, what many people don't realize is that the treadmill has a an extensive and varied history. It has been used to punish and as a tool for construction, and even as an instrument for medical use. In actuality it has evolved so much over the years that one could be left wondering what shape the treadmill will take in the future.

    The first treadmill in the modern age was invented in 1818 by a professional English civil engineer named Sir William Cubitt. He was working to improve the British prisons at the time and believed that prisoners could be helped to recover through hard work. Cubitt's concept was that a machine powered by humans, similar to a wheel you walk on, whose cogs lock, would keep prisoners moving throughout the day. His version of a treadmill was referred to as a tread-wheel, consisted of a huge broad wheel that prisoners stood on while being pressed down by their feet.

    The machine was so successful that it quickly caught the attention of activists for reform in prisons. According to the British Library a group called the Society for the Improvement of Prison Discipline seized on the idea and began to use the machine in prisons. In the summer, prisoners worked on the machines for 10 hours a day. In winter, they worked seven hours. The program was so successful that it was adopted by prisons all over the world.

    The JLL T350 Digital Folding Treadmill

    The JLL T350 treadmill is an excellent treadmill for anyone who wants to get fit at home in comfort. It is a great machine (both in terms of speed and incline) to appeal to advanced runners, but is friendly enough to get beginners on the treadmill too. It also offers a comfortable and well cushioned running surface that goes smooth on joints while providing an amazing workout.

    This treadmill is easy to fold and store. It is also equipped with wheels that make it easy to move around your room. The frame is durable, and it feels strong enough to handle vigorous use. The large safety bars that pop out from the display area in front are a nice feature. It's a big item at 59kg, and you'll need assistance to install it. Once it's up and running, it is easy to use and maintain.

    The large 5 inch LCD screen appears outdated, but it functions well and displays all of the important metrics of your workout clearly. It shows your distance, time along with speed, heart rate and calories burned. You can also select among 20 professional running programs pre-programmed by professionals and adjust the intensity of your workout by using the incline button, which is located conveniently on the handrails.

    Powered by an 4.5HP motor, this treadmill sale uk is able to reach the highest speed of 18km/h, which is more than enough for even the most experienced runners. The cushioned deck is incredibly comfy and the 16 point cushioning system does a great job of keeping your knees and ankles at ease while running.

    The console features a USB interface and Bluetooth wireless connectivity, which allows users to connect an iPhone, iPod or MP3 Player and play music while you exercise. The JLL T350 also comes with built-in speakers, so you can listen to your favourite podcasts while working out. If you're in need of an interruption, you can use the Pause button to stop and pick up where you were when you left.
